Adc interfacing with 8085 pdf file

Adc 0809 is a monolithic cmos device, with an 8bit ad converter, 8channel multiplexer and microprocessor compatible control logic. Interfacing adc with three ldr using microcontroller and lcd. The converter is designed to give fast, accurate, and repeatable conversions over a wide range of temperatures. Microprocessor and interfacing notes pdf mpi pdf notes book starts with the topics vector interrupt table, timing diagram, interrupt structure of 8086. Interface 8255 with 8085 microprocessor for addition. Jan 01, 2017 memory interfacing with 8085 microprocessor theory 1. Microprocessor 8085 b ram 8085 notes free download as word doc. This tutorial will provide you basic information regarding this adc, testing in free run mode and interfacing example with 8051 with sample program in c and assembly. Interfacing 8259 with 8085 microprocessor it requires two internal address and they are a 0 or a 1. The low order data bus lines d0d7 are connected to d0 d7 of 8259. Interfacing 8255 with 8086 microprocessor interfacing. Interfacing adc to 8051 adc analog to digital converter forms a very essential part in many embedded projects and this article is about interfacing an adc to 8051 embedded controller. Also learn about the serial and parallel communication interfaces. This site is like a library, use search box in the widget to get ebook that you want.

Mode, the ale 8085 or sync 8080 signal, the static ram or slow memory interface mode, and not in the rom mode. How to interface adc 0809 with 8085 lab trainer kit top brain computer interface projects 2019click. The interface card to study the iv characteristics of a pn diode. Programming using arithmetic, logical and bit manipulation instructions of 8051 11. Serial communication between two microprocessor kits using 8251. Microprocessor 8085 is the basic processor from which machine language programming can be learnt. The 16bit data of the specified register pair are added to the contents of the hl register. The interfacing of adc0801 is presented in this section. Unit 6 data converters 5 hrs programmable peripheral interface ic8255, introduction to adc and dac and their types, adc ic080809 and dac ic080809, interfacing ic8255 to 8085, interfacing adc ic080809 and dac ic080809 to 8085. Explain the interfacing of a 8 bit adc 0801 with 8085 with neat schematics and timing diagram. Its data bus width is 8bit and address bus width is 16bit, thus it can address 216 64 kb of memory. Some external adc chips are 0803,0804,0808,0809 and there are many more. Q22 explain the stack memory of 8085 microprocessor with the help of instructions and neat diagrams in detail.

The ram memory is used to store temporary programs and data. Each instruction is represented by an 8bit binary value. It has 28 pins, and can handle upto 8 analog signals using one chip. Learning objective 3 interfacing of a to d converter with 8085 microprocessor the objective of chapter is to interface the 8085 microprocessor interfaced and programmable peripheral interface ic 8255 with dac, adc, stepper motor and temperature controller with the help of latches and decoder. No need for external zero or full scale adjustment 5. Jul 11, 2018 the 8085 microprocessor has 5 seven basic machine cycles. Nov 28, 2014 this video demonstrates the interfacing of adc0800 and dac0800 with 8085 microprocessor by using 8155. The 8085 8080aprogramming model includes six registers, one accumulator, and one flag register, as shown in figure. Interfacing adcanalog to digital converter with 8085. To interface the adc with 8085, we need 8255 programmable peripheral interface chip with it. The main ics which are to be interfaced with 8085 are.

The instruction stores 16bit data into the register pair designated in the operand. The 8085 microprocessor architecture programming and. This site is like a library, use search box in the widget to get ebook that. It can be either memory mapped or io mapped in the system. A typical multichannel device has one or two lvds pairs per adc channel, one common bit clock output, and one frame clock output. Here you can download the free lecture notes of microprocessor and interfacing pdf notes mpi notes pdf materials with multiple file links to download. Section interfacing chapters 12 and detailed realworld the to lcds, stepper motors, and adc devices, then program it using. Interfacing adc adc with submitted by admin on 5 september am. Microprocessor and interfacing pdf notes mpi notes pdf. Microcontroller boards8085 microprocessor it doesnt have an on chip adc to accept the digital input, it will not accept analog input, so we need a adc to process the analog signal. Draw the internal block diagram of 8086 and explain.

Click download or read online button to get 8085 microprocessor interfacing and applications book now. Designed for an undergraduate course on the 8085 microprocessor, this text provides comprehensive coverage of the programming and interfacing of the 8bit microprocessor. A simple interfacing project with the 8085 microprocessor kits available in under graduate college labs has been discussed. Here rd and wr signals are activated when iom signal is high, indicating io bus cycle. This tutorial describes how to interface adc to based mircocontroller. It is a 40 pin c package fabricated on a single lsi chip. Written in a simple and easytounderstand manner, this book introduces the reader to the basics and the architecture of the 8085. Interface 8255 with 8085 microprocessor for addition problem interface 8255 with 8085 microprocessor and write an assembly program that determines the addition of contents of port a and port b and store the result in port c.

How to interface adc 0809 with 8085 lab trainer kit. Adc0808adc0809 is an 8 channel 8bit analog to digital converter. Here, programmable peripheral interface, 8255 is used as parallel port to send the digital data to dac. Tutorial on introduction to 8085 architecture and programming.

Lecture note on microprocessor and microcontroller theory. The chip select cs signal from the decoder of the microprocessor system is delayed and inverted to clock the latch. The interfacing of 8259 to 8085 is shown in figure is io mapped in the system. The converter is partitioned into 3 major sections. This is a 3byte instruction, the second byte specifies the loworder address and the third byte specifies the highorder address. Write an assembly language procedure to read the converted digital data through data bus. Today we are going to interface 8channel adc with at89s52 microcontroller namely adc08080809. Interfacing adcanalog to digital converter with 8085 description. Unlike, pic microcontroller, arduino and avr microcontroller, 8051 microcontroller do not have built in adc.

Stepper motor is an electromechanical device that rotates through fixed angular steps when digital inputs are applied. Refer to figure 12for the lvds output interface of an 8channel adc device. Follow the initial 3 steps of interfacing of 8255 with 8085 that are given before. Stepper motor interfacing 8085 microprocessor course. Adc 0804 is the adc used here and before going through the interfacing procedure, we must neatly understand how the adc 0804 works. Understanding serial lvds capture in highspeed adcs. The pc 7 pin of port c upper is connected to the end of conversion eoc pin of. Address and data bus, control signal generation and memory interfacing.

Let us see the circuit diagram of connecting 8085, 8255 and the adc converter. Peripheralinterfacing of 8085 free 8085 microprocessor. The dac0830 digital to analog converter is connected to 8086 microprocessor, as shown in the fig. Subtract the register or the memory from the accumulator. The article also provides a sample tested technology is an online.

Jul 22, 2019 adc0808 interfacing with 8051 pdf this tutorial describes how to interface adc to based mircocontroller. Figure shows the interfacing of adc 0804 to the 8086 microprocessor. Microprocessor 8085 architecture, instruction set, interface and. The adc can be interfaced to 8085 microprocessor system through tristate buffer or port devices such as 82558155. Instruction set of 8085 an instruction is a binary pattern designed inside a microprocessor to perform a specific function. Download the 8085 microprocessor architecture programming and interfacing or read online books in pdf, epub, tuebl, and mobi format. The adc0801 is a single channel, 8bit successive approximation type ad converter from national semiconductor corporation. The time for the back cycle of the intel 8085 a2 is 200 ns. Pdf memory interfacing in 8086 tufail abbas academia. To perform addition of two 8 bit numbers using 8085. The entire group of instructions that a microprocessor supports is called instruction set. Typical multichannel adc with a serial lvds interface 6 understanding serial lvds capture in highspeedadcs sbaa205 july 20.

Intel 8085 8bit microprocessor intel 8085 is an 8bit, nmos microprocessor. If the dac is memory mapped then the cs is from memory decoder. Engage your students during remote learning with video readalouds. Business innovation centre, innova park, mollison avenue, enfield, middlesex, en3 7xu tel. Click download or read online button to get the 8085 microprocessor architecture programming and interfacing book now. The 8085 trainer kit consists of 8085 mpu ic 8kb eprom 8kb ram keyboard and display controller 8279 programmable peripheral interface 8255ppi 21 key hexkeypad six numbers of seven segment leds the adc interface board consists of. Adc 0808, which is an 8bit converter with eight channels of input. A microprocessor can contact the external world only through interfacing.

Microprocessors and microcontrollers lab dept of ece. If the dac is io mapped then cs is from io decoder. If you continue browsing the site, you agree to the use of cookies on this website. Dec 02, 2019 view notes interfacing with from electrical ee at engineering college. Interfacing adc0808adc0809 with 8051 microcontroller. This video demonstrates the interfacing of adc0800 and dac0800 with 8085 microprocessor by using 8155. The first criterion for judging a dac is its resolution, which is a function of number of binary inputs. The 8085 8080a has six generalpurpose registers to store 8bit data. Interfacing of terfacing of ram and rom with 8085 datasheet, cross reference, circuit and application notes in pdf format.

Mar 07, 2016 interfacing technique with 8085 analog to digital converter 08080809 sl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Dac0830 digital to analog converter interfacing dac 0830. Also learn about the peripheral programmed devices designed by intel. How to convert pdf to word without software duration. In this project at89s52 microcontroller is interfaced with adc ic to show the output value of adc on lcd screen,for a given variable input voltage. Using 8085 microprocessor system, write a program to implement the same. Nvis 5585a advanced 8085 microprocessor trainer l l l l l study of 8085 architecture 8085 assembly language programming interfacing of 8085 with adc interfacing of 8085 with dac peripheral interfacing operating frequency. The digitaltoanalog converterdac is a device widely used to convert digital pulse to analog signals. Parallel communication between two microprocessors using 8255. Peripheral interfacing is considered to be a main part of microprocessor, as it is the only way to interact with the external world.

Microprocessors and interfacing 8086, 8051, 8096, and. It is suitable for precise position, speed and direction control which are required in automation system. The interfacing happens with the ports of the microprocessor. In present time there are lots of microcontrollers in market which has inbuilt adc with one or more channels. The general procedure for interfacing static memory to 8086 is as follows. One of these channels is selected by sending address to a address line of adc. Interfacing is one of the important concepts in microprocessors engineering. When we select 8051 microcontroller family for making any project, in which we need of an adc conversion, then we use external adc. Jan 30, 2016 and by using their adc register we can interface. This is to certify that the thesis entitled analog to digital convertor interface with microcontroller, submitted by debanand majhi roll. Unlike adc0804 which has one analog channel, this adc has 8 multiplexed analog input channels.

262 1047 328 101 85 1099 493 162 530 662 158 1339 1241 1180 410 295 637 1308 569 715 1249 439 825 1312 569 4 1044 266 1266 474 183 1086